  • Which is the cheapest airport to fly into in Ontario?

    Prices will differ depending on the departure airport, but generally, the cheapest airport to fly to in Ontario is Toronto Region of Waterloo Intl Airport (YKF), with an average flight price of C$ 158.

  • What is the cheapest day to fly to Ontario?

    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Ontario is Friday when round-trip tickets can be as cheap as C$ 340.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Sunday, when round-trip prices are C$ 443 on average.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Ontario?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Ontario is generally at night, when round-trip flights cost C$ 238 on average. Morning departures are around 24%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Ontario is generally in the morning,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is C$ 316.

  • What is the cheapest flight to Ontario?

    The cheapest ticket to Ontario from Alberta found in the last 72 hours was to Hamilton, at C$ 90 round-trip. The most popular route is Edmonton (YEG) to Hamilton (YHM) and the cheapest round-trip airline ticket found on this route in the last 72 hours was C$ 90.

  • What is the cheapest month to fly from Alberta to Ontario?

    The cheapest month for flights from Alberta to Ontario is September, when tickets cost C$ 252 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and April,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is C$ 564 and C$ 549 respectively.

  • How far in advance should I book a flight from Alberta to Ontario?

    To get a below-average price on the flight from Alberta to Ontario,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 6 weeks before departure.

  • How long is the flight to Ontario?

    An average direct flight from Alberta to Ontario takes 6h 42m, covering a distance of 4239 km. The shortest route is Calgary (YYC) to Thunder Bay (YQT) with an average flight time of 2h 40m.

  • What are the most popular destinations in Ontario?

    Based on KAYAK flight searches, the most popular destination is Ottawa (82% of total searches to Ontario). The next most popular destinations are London (9%) and Windsor (4%). Searches for flights to Thunder Bay (3%), to Sudbury (2%), and to Timmins (0%) are also popular.
